Soffits play a necessary function in roofing system architecture and ventilation systems, adding to the overall longevity and looks of a home. A soffit, which refers to the underside of an architectural feature, typically hides rafters or [Eaves Repair](https://historydb.date/wiki/16_Facebook_Pages_You_Must_Follow_For_Fascia_Replacement_Marketers) ductwork, while providing ventilation to avoid wetness buildup. When it comes to soffit installation, expert knowledge and exact techniques are vital. Measurement and Cutting
The initial step includes measuring the location where the soffit will be set up. Precise measurements are important for a tight fit which boosts both performance and look.

Suggestion: Always measure two times before cutting as soon as!
Compute Total Length: Measure the perimeter of the eaves.Cut the Panels: Using a circular saw, cut the soffit panels to meet the required dimensions.3. Installation of Soffit PanelsAttaching the F-J-ChannelSecure the F-J-Channel: Begin by connecting the F-J-channel along the eaves of the building, ensuring it's level. This channel supports the ends of your soffit panels.Inserting the Soffit PanelsSlide in the Panels: Insert the very first [Soffit Board Replacement](https://pads.jeito.nl/sek_982BQ-qmPVYQsxfpHg/) panel into the F-J-channel, ensuring it locks safely at the edge.Securing: Use the recommended fasteners to connect the panel to the structure underneath, following the producer's standards for spacing.4. Ventilation Considerations
Appropriate ventilation is important for maintaining a healthy attic area. When installing soffits:
Include Soffit Vents: Depending on your home's ventilation requirements, include [Soffit Repair](https://500px.com/p/gustavsenrerhede) vents to permit air to stream freely into the attic.Examine Local Codes: Adhere to local building regulations concerning ventilation to make sure compliance.5. Vinyl is typically advised due to its rot resistance and low maintenance requirements.
How typically should soffits be checked or replaced?
House owners ought to check their soffits at least as soon as a year for damages or indications of pests. Replacement might be required every 20 to 30 years, depending upon the material and climate.
